Study | No. (exercise vs control) | Age(y) | Kidney Function | Design | Training | Outcomes in exercise group |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Clyne22 | 10 vs 9 | 47 ± 8 | 15 ±7 mL/min/1.73 m2 | RCT | Increase in: max work rate, muscle strength | |
Eidemak3 | 15 vs 15 | 44.5 | 25 (range, 10–43) mL/min/1.73m2 | RCT | 20 mo, 30 min cycling & other activities | Increase in max work capacity No change in GFR |
Boyce4 | 8 vs 0 | 50.4 ± 6.8 | Single-subject reversal | 4 mo, 3×/wk, walking & cycling <=60 min at 70% HR | Increase in: VO2peak, vent threshold Decrease in: SBP, DBP |
|
Heiwe23 | 16 vs 9 (older age) | 74 ±6 | 17 ± 5 mL/min | Quasi- experimental controlled | 12 wk, 3×/wk, strength training (20 reps/leg at 60% of 1RM) & 30 min low- intensity exercise | Increase in: 1RM, 6 min walk distance, “get up and go” functional mobility, dynamic & static strength No change in sickness impact on profile |
Pechter36 | 17 vs 9 | 50 | 66.8 ± 9.1 mL/min | Quasi- experimental controlled | 12 wk, 2×/wk, low-intensity water exercise for 30 min/session | Increase in: VO2peak, peak work rate, glutathione Decrease in: lipid peroxidase, proteinuria |
Leehey8 | 7 vs 4 (diabetic, obese) | 66 | 44 ± 36 mL/min/1.73m2 | RCT (pilot study) | 24 wk (3×/wk for 6 wk & home exercise for 18 wk), 40 min/session at 45–85% VO2peak | Increase in treadmill time No change in proteinuria |
Mustata9 | 8 vs 10 | 68 | 27.5 mL/min/1.73m2 | RCT (pilot study) | 12 mo, 2×/wk supervised (treadmill, cycling) & 3×/wk home walking, <= 60 min at 60% VO2peak | Increase in: VO2peak, treadmill walking time, arterial augmentation index Clinically meaningful increase in HRQoL |
Casteneda5,24; Balakrishnan25 | 14 vs 12 | 65±10 | 29.5 ± 27.4 mL/min/1.73 m2 | RCT | 12 wk, 3×/wk, 80% of 1RM | Increase in: muscle strength, type I & type II muscle fiber size, mDNA, leucine oxidation, serum prealbumin Decrease in: CRP, IL-6 |
Toyama39 | 10 vs 9 | 71.7 ± 11 | 47.5±11.6 | Quasi- experimental controlled | 12 wk, 1×/wk supervised 30 min cycling & 30 min home walking | Increase in: ventilatory threshold, LDL cholesterol, eGFR Decrease in triglycerides |
Gregory10 | 10 vs 11 | 55.0±11.1 | 0.65 ±0.35 mL/s/1.73 m2 | RCT | 48 wk, 3×/wk, aerobic exercise, 55 min/session at 50%-60% VO2peak; also, starting at 24 wk, 2×/wk resistance exercise (1–2 sets of 15 reps major muscle groups) | Increase in: VO2peak, treadmill time, leg strength No change in IGF-1, IGF-2, IGFBP-1, IGFBP-2 |
Abbreviations: IGF-1: insulin like growth factor 1, IGF-2: insulin like growth factor 2, IGFBP-1, insulin-like growth factor binding protein 1; IGFBP-2; insulin-like growth factor binding protein 2; VO2:peak, peak oxygen consumption; eGFR: estimated glomerular filtration rate, 1RM, 1-repetition maximum (maximum amount of weight that can be lifted in a single repetition): RCT: randomized controlled trial, CRP: C-reactive protein, IL-6, interleukin 6; GFR: glomerular filtration rate; max, maximum; SBP, systolic blood pressure; DBP, diastolic blood pressure; HR, heart rate; HRQoL, health-related quality of life; mDNA, mitochondrial DNA; LDL, low-density lipoprotein; CKD, chronic kidney disease.
